RW has obviously had a pretty big benefit of playing with a pretty good RB and a very good defense. He is also very intelligent, is very athletic and works very hard. He is a good QB and seems to be getting better. Would he not look as good without the RB and defense? Probably not, but that's true for everybody.

But he has certainly shown he can make read the defenses, avoid pressure, has pocket awareness, an accurate arm to make pretty much any throw you can ask a qb to make and the work ethic to get better every year.

I don't think he's Manning, Rodgers, Brees, Brady league yet. But he's certainly pretty good. I think all those qb's have had adversity to overcome and play well (overall, everyone has a bad game now and again) in all sorts of conditions. I don't know that RW has had that yet, but I'm betting he has all the physical and mental tools to make that leap from very good to elite qb in this league.


ETA: I don't think Manziel has those same qualities. I think he gets by on talent alone in college and he's going to find the talent level is a lot better across the board in the NFL. He'll make some highlight reels, but I don't think he has the rest of what is needed to put in the time and work to be very good in the NFL. I'm not even sure his skill set transfers well to the NFL other than gimmick and high light plays, but not the consistency that will get you to the playoffs and win games.
